Article
Impact of loci nature on estimating recombination and mutation rates in Chlamydia trachomatis.
G3 (Bethesda, Md.) - 1 Jul 2012
Ferreira Rita, Borges Vítor, Nunes Alexandra, Nogueira Paulo Jorge, Borrego Maria José, Gomes João Paulo
Abstract excerpt
The knowledge of the frequency and relative weight of mutation and recombination events in evolution is essential for understanding how microorganisms reach fitted phenotypes. Traditionally, these evolutionary parameters have been inferred by using data from multilocus sequence typing (MLST), which is known to have yielded conflicting results.
